The United People's Party (Bulgarian: Единна народна партия, romanized: Edinna narodna partiya; ENP) is a political party in Bulgaria. The chairwoman of the party is Valentina Vasileva-Filadelfevs.
History
The party ran in the April 2021 election as part of the Stand Up! Mafia, Get Out! coalition, and won three seats.
